The Itinerary — A Closer Look

Sailing Along the Sorrento Coastline

The adventure begins with a gentle cruise along the familiar scenery of Sorrento’s coast. As you leave the busy port behind, you’ll have a chance to enjoy the panoramic views of the cliffs, colorful towns, and the shimmering sea. It’s a peaceful way to start your day, especially if you’re used to busy land excursions.

View of Marina Grande

From the water, you’ll see the charming fishing village of Marina Grande. It’s a lovely photo op and a good way to appreciate the local flavor of Sorrento’s seaside life, away from the usual crowds.

Roman Villa from the Sea

One of the highlights is catching sight of an ancient Roman villa dating back to the 1st century BC. Seeing historical ruins from the water adds a special touch to this trip, giving you a glimpse into the area’s long history without the hassle of land-based tours.

Marine Reserve and Athena’s Temple

You’ll pass by Punta Campanella, a protected marine reserve, where clear waters and rich marine life thrive. From the boat, you can admire an ancient temple dedicated to Athena — a reminder of the area’s mythic past. This part of the coast is less visited by travelers, making it a peaceful and awe-inspiring experience.

The Legendary Li Galli Islands

A major highlight is the stop at the Li Galli archipelago, known in legends as the home of mermaids and the Sirens. The story of Ulysses and the Sirens is legendary, and you’ll get to float in these legendary waters if you decide to swim. Trust us, the scenery here is magical — the perfect blend of myth and reality.

The boat allows a 30-minute swim or simply relaxing on deck, soaking in the views and stories. It’s a free stop, meaning no extra charge, and the setting is truly special.

Amalfi Town

Next, you’ll anchor in Amalfi for about two hours. This gives you plenty of time to swim in the blue waters, explore the quaint streets, or grab a bite in a local café. Amalfi is a favorite for many, with its historic cathedral, narrow alleyways, and lively atmosphere.

In reviews, travelers appreciated having enough time to explore freely. One reviewer said, “We had enough time in every stop to explore,” which is exactly what a private tour can offer—without feeling rushed.

Hidden Inlet Along the Coast

The tour also includes a stop at a characteristic inlet along the coast, a quieter, more intimate spot to enjoy the sea and take photos. These lesser-known spots make the experience feel more genuine and less touristy.

Positano — The Vertical Town

The next big highlight is Positano, often called the most picture-perfect village in Italy. The boat drops anchor near Positano beach, where you can swim and then wander through charming alleyways lined with boutiques and cafes. You’ll have about two hours here, enough to grab a gelato, browse shops, or simply relax by the colorful houses clinging to the cliffside.

Many reviews note how much they loved this stop. One said, “Stop for a swim in the blue water of the Amalfi Coast dropping the anchor near Positano beach. Free time for a stroll along the beach and/or through the town’s charming alleyways,” capturing the relaxed, picturesque vibe.

Return and Disembarkation

By 5:00 pm, you’ll head back to Sorrento. The journey back offers chances to reflect on the day, enjoy some final views, and maybe even share a toast with the included prosecco.

FAQ

From Sorrento: Amalfi Coast Private Boat Day Tour - FAQ

Is there a specific start time for the tour?
Yes, the tour begins at 9:00 am from the Piazza Marinai d’Italia in Sorrento. Make sure to arrive a little early to check in.

What is included in the price?
Your price covers a professional skipper, snorkeling gear, beach towels, soft drinks, beer, a bottle of prosecco, restroom, and shower facilities on board. Tips are not included.

How long is the tour?
The tour lasts approximately 7 to 8 hours, giving you ample time to explore, swim, and relax at each stop.

Are there any additional costs?
Yes, fuel (€400) is paid at the meeting point before embarking, and there’s a €10 fee per person for assistance and reception at embarkation. Lunch is not included, and tips are extra if you wish to tip the crew.

Can I cancel if the weather is bad?
Yes, cancellations are free up to 24 hours before the start. Bad weather might cancel the trip, but in that case, you’ll be offered a different date or full refund.

Is this tour suitable for children?
Many reviews mention traveling with children, including a family with a six-year-old, so it seems manageable with kids, especially given the provided towels and snorkeling gear. However, keep in mind that the boat trip lasts several hours and involves some swimming.

Do we need to bring anything?
Aside from personal essentials, everything necessary like snorkeling gear and towels is provided. Just bring sunscreen, a hat, and your camera.

Is it a private tour?
Yes, this is a truly private experience, with only your group participating. No strangers join your boat.
